Welcome to the Pixelgrove plugin SDK. Known issue: the ThumbCache in Pixelgrove 4.2 leaks decoded bitmaps when plugins request scaled variants without releasing handles. Always call releaseVariant() in your teardown hook. If the host process OOMs during testing, reset the cache vault before reattaching the debugger. The reset tool will prompt for the passphrase shown below.

unlock words, hahip-baduf: holwyn-istath-julvan

**Handover Note — Eastvale Sales Review**

To my successor: the Eastvale regional review is half complete. Margon Bros. accounts are stable, but the Rillford cluster needs renegotiation before year-end. Petra Slane holds the working files and knows every account's history. Prioritize her debrief in your first week. The confidential note on business plans follows directly below.

board note of kageg-bahof: The renewal with Holwynax Holdings closes at $2 million a year, 5 percent below the last contract. Project Ulaath slips by two quarters because of the supplier delay.

## Who to Contact: Upstream Circuit Breaker

The Fennelgate breaker guards calls from Orchardly to the Mistral Quote API. Trip thresholds and cooldown windows live in the resilience config repo; do not change them without review from the reliability guild. Routine tuning questions go to the service owners, while trip-storm incidents should be escalated directly. Reach the responsible team at the address below.

alerts address for faduf-yajeg: drumir@nelvroworks.internal